Tree Management
Propagated by seeds, cuttings, seedlings and air layering
Climate Change Adaptability
unknown
Tree Benefits and Uses
Farmer Uses
- Lumber
Wood: used to make boxes or figurines
Farm Services
- Unknown
Biodiversity Benefits
Yes
Its very fragrant flowers attract various insects such as native bees
